MarenSeattle, G'morning! imo, it was Tom Ford who launched the palette Dimitri refers to in his presentation. I came to that conclusion after running a Google image search for shade and illuminate palette and highlighting and shading palette. Here is the Tom Ford palette.
 photo 02d99053-3ed5-4465-8744-5af2f4dad47e_zpsf62faa14.jpg

Tom Ford Shade & Illuminate Palette
- .49 oz - launched for $75.00, now $77.00.
It's made in Canada.
Ingredient deck pasted below.

 photo 86c0da1c-2d1d-4c7d-8c81-de573003da82_zps53019b04.jpg

SKINN Contour Pro Highlighting & Shading Palette
- 0.30 oz. Currently priced @ $49.31 on shopHQ (includes sponge)
It's made in China.
INGREDIENTS:
**Highlighter: Ethylhexyl Palmitate, Mica, Ozokerite, Dimethicone, Hydrogenated Palm Oil, Hydrogenated Microcrystalline Wax, Beeswax, Stearic acid, Stearyl stearate, Silica Dimethyl Silylate, Phenoxyethanol, Caprylyl Glycol, Tocopheryl Acetate, Tin Oxide MAY CONTAIN: Yellow 5 Lake, Titanium Dioxide, Iron Oxides
**Shade Color: Ethylhexyl Palmitate, Polybutene, Octyldodecanol, Ozokerite, Hydrogenated Palm Oil, Bis-glyceryl Polyacryladipate-2, Mica, Beeswax, Wax Microcristallina, Stearic Acid, Stearyl Stearate, Phenoxyethanol, Caprylyl Glycol, Tocopheryl Acetat. MAY CONTAIN: Yellow 5 Lake, Titanium Dioxide, Red 6 Lake, Blue 1 Lake, Iron Oxides.
